Comment by madeofpalk

17 hours ago

Apple has 40 retail stores in the UK with thousands of employees. They have a big new HQ in London where they have engineering, etc there.

I cannot see Apple completely shutting down in the UK, firing thousands of staff, selling off any property, and cancelling leases, just for a week long bargaining chip.